As a woman of color, an out lesbian, and a democrat, Sheriff Lupe Valdez was an unlikely candidate for the position as Dallas County Sheriff. On the day when she was elected to office, the Dallas Morning News stated, incredulously, that “Dallas county voters managed to shatter at least four different stereotypes in one fell swoop." In this featured address, Sheriff Valdez addresses the difficulty of representing and managing “at least four” disparate and complicated identities within the world of law enforcement in the conservative state of Texas.

Since setting up a trans-owned production company in Hollywood in 2003, founders Andrea James and Calpernia Addams have produced groundbreaking events and media for and about the transgender community. They will talk about their work with Felicity Huffman and writer/director Duncan Tucker on the 2005 film Transamerica. They will also discuss their work with Eve Ensler and Jane Fonda on the first all-transgender performance of The Vagina Monologues in 2004, and how the media influences the struggle for trans rights and acceptance. They will show clips from recent and upcoming projects by Deep Stealth Productions, as well as some recent media appearances in documentaries and news shows, with comments on strategies for using the media to promote your work and your message.
